Respondents PRAYER: Petition filed under Article 226 of the Constitution of India, praying for issuance of a writ of Mandamus directing the second respondent to release the petitioner's JCB vehicle, bearing registration No.TN-48 BX-1132 from the custody of the third respondent's police and to hand over the above vehicle to the petitioner, by considering his representation dated 10.08.2021 within the time limit that may be stipulated by this Court. For Petitioner : Mr.R.Maheswaran For Respondents : Mr.P.Thilakkumar Standing Counsel for Government
ORDER
(Order of this Court was made by M.DURAISWAMY,J.) The petitioner, who is claiming to be the owner of the vehicle, seeks release of the same by filing the writ petition, pursuant to his representation dated 10.08.2021.
2.This Court had already held that the remedy open to the petitioner is to approach the jurisdictional designated Court and not to invoke the extraordinary jurisdiction of this Court. This is also for the reason that the power of confiscation is available to the designated Court. Though an F.I.R., has been registered, the offence involved would include Section 21(1) of the Mines and https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/ 1/2
W.P(MD)No.15989 of 2021 Minerals Act. Such a situation had already been taken note of by way of a clarification by this Court indicating the procedure to be followed. Thus, the present writ petition stands closed, giving liberty to the petitioner to work out his remedy in the manner known to law in tune with the order of the Division Bench. In the event of filing a petition before the jurisdictional designated Court, the said Court is expected to dispose of the same, on merits and in accordance with law, within a period of four weeks from the date of receipt of such an application.
